  Unable to set up 2 separate X screens on 12.04 (this works on 10.04).
- 
  What I did: fresh install of Ubuntu 64bits. Then upgraded. Then try to
- set up 2 separate X screens (2 monitors).
- 
- It didn't work on nouveau, nvidia-current, nvidia (post release
- updates), and nvidia-experimental-310.
- 
- The behaviour is the same regardless of the driver used:
+ set up 2 separate X screens (2 monitors). It didn't work on nouveau,
+ nvidia-current, nvidia (post release updates), and nvidia-
+ experimental-310.
  
  First the 2nd monitor is complete blank, with an X as a mouse cursor (X
- Windows default?) . This follow the same description follow in this bug:
- https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/nautilus/+bug/885989
- 
- 'killall nautilus' shows the default background, but no top panel, no
- launcher, and same mouse cursor. Launching any instance of nautilus
- blanks the screen again.
- 
- I dug a little further and I found this bug:
- https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/unity/+bug/661450
- 
- running 'DISPLAY=:0.1 compiz --replace' offers a little improvement: top
- panel appears, as the unity launcher. However, no windows decorations
- and all windows open stick to the upper left corner. They can't be
- moved.
- 
- After restarting the machine all back to zero.
